Linux 系统故障排除和修复指南365


作为一个经验丰富的 Linux 系统管理员,我深知对系统故障进行有效排除和修复的重要性。在本文中,我将深入探讨 Linux 系统故障排除和修复的各种方面,提供详细的步骤、最佳实践和专家提示,帮助您快速、高效地恢复系统正常运行。

故障排除过程

故障排除过程通常涉及几个关键步骤:
收集信息:收集有关系统问题的尽可能多的信息,包括出现故障的时间、系统错误消息和最近的配置更改。
分析日志:检查系统日志(例如 /var/log/syslog 和 /var/log/),查找与问题相关的错误或警告消息。
检查进程:使用命令行工具(例如 ps 和 top)检查正在运行的进程,查找可能导致问题的异常行为或资源占用过高。
测试硬件:在可能的情况下,使用诊断工具(例如 memtest 和 smartctl)测试硬件组件,以排除潜在的硬件故障。

常见问题和修复方法

以下是一些最常见的 Linux 系统故障及其相应的修复方法:

启动失败



问题:系统无法启动,显示错误消息或卡在启动屏幕。
修复:

检查引导加载程序配置并确保其正确。
尝试启动进入恢复模式并修复启动文件。
检查硬件组件是否连接正确且正常工作。



文件系统错误



问题:文件系统损坏,导致文件访问失败或系统不稳定。
修复:

使用 fsck 工具检查并修复文件系统。
重新安装受影响的文件系统。
恢复文件系统备份(如果可用)。



内存不足



问题:系统内存不足,导致应用程序崩溃或性能下降。
修复:

增加系统的物理内存(RAM)。
优化内存使用,使用 swap 空间或内存管理工具。
关闭不必要的应用程序和服务。



网络连接问题



问题:系统无法连接到网络或连接不稳定。
修复:

检查网络电缆和连接器是否正确连接。
使用 ping 命令测试网络连接性。
检查防火墙规则和网络配置设置。



最佳实践

以下是进行 Linux 系统故障排除的最佳实践:
记录变动:始终记录对系统进行的任何更改,以便在出现问题时轻松撤消更改。
使用日志监控:定期检查系统日志并监视警报,以主动检测潜在问题。
禁用不必要的服务:禁用不需要的应用程序和服务可以释放资源并减少潜在故障点。
定期备份:定期备份系统,以便在发生故障时能够轻松恢复数据和配置。
寻求专业帮助:如果无法自行解决问题,请考虑联系 Linux 系统管理员或支持论坛寻求专业帮助。


Linux 系统故障排除和修复是一项至关重要的技能,可以保持系统正常运行和提高生产力。通过遵循本文中概述的步骤、最佳实践和专家提示,您将能够有效地诊断和解决各种系统问题,确保您的 Linux 环境稳定可靠。

2025-01-05


上一篇:Linux 系统开发:深入实践指南

下一篇:地铁 iOS 系统:深入解读其核心优势